PRESS RELEASE 08/4/2007

Americans men Stolfus and Wong won the gold  

SANTO DOMINGO, Dominican Republic, April 8, 2007.- American  men’s pair of  Scott Wong and Hans Stolfus won the gold medal of the Boca Chica Tournament, the first leg of the 2007 NORCECA Beach Volleyball Circuit, with a 21-19, 21-10 victory over Marcelo Araya and Jonathan Guevara of Costa Rica.

Cuban Yunieski Ramirez and Yoendris Kindelán won the bronze medal in defeating Jorge Bolanos and Jose Gonzalez of Guatemala by 21-9, 21-14.

“The first set shows how good the Costa Ricans are,” said Stolfus after the match. “It was a tough battle, but we were able to put together a good streak in the second set.”

And Wong added: “We lacked consistency in the first set, but the we were able to focus and that was the difference.”

The USA team made to the finals with victories over Dominican Republic III (Edward Rogers-Alejandro Flores) 21-13, 21-11 and Cuba 21-8, 21-16. Costa Rica reached the gold medal match with triumphs over El Salvador (Geovanny Medrano-David Vargas) 21-19, 21-18 and Guatemala 21-14, 21-15.

Men’s results on Sunday:

Quarterfinals: CUB d. PUR II (21-14, 21-19); USA d. DOM III (21-13, 21-11); GUA d. PUR I (21-13, 21-9); Semi finals: USA d. CUB (21-8, 21-16); CRC d. GUA (21-14, 21-15). Bronze: CUB d. GUA (21-9, 21-14). Gold: USA d. CRC (21-19, 21-10).
